+Subject: [PATCH] flow_offload: add control flag checking helpers
+MIME-Version: 1.0
+Content-Type: text/plain; charset=UTF-8
+Content-Transfer-Encoding: 8bit
+
+These helpers aim to help drivers, with checking
+for the presence of unsupported control flags.
+
+For drivers supporting at least one control flag:
+  flow_rule_is_supp_control_flags()
+
+For drivers using flow_rule_match_control(), but not using flags:
+  flow_rule_has_control_flags()
+
+For drivers not using flow_rule_match_control():
+  flow_rule_match_has_control_flags()
+
+While primarily aimed at FLOW_DISSECTOR_KEY_CONTROL
+and flow_rule_match_control(), then the first two
+can also be used with FLOW_DISSECTOR_KEY_ENC_CONTROL
+and flow_rule_match_enc_control().
+
+These helpers mirrors the existing check done in sfc:
+  drivers/net/ethernet/sfc/tc.c +276
+
+Only compile-tested.

+Subject: [PATCH] ipv6: Add ipv6_addr_{cpu_to_be32,be32_to_cpu} helpers
+
+Add helpers to convert an ipv6 addr, expressed as an array
+of words, from CPU to big-endian byte order, and vice versa.
+
+No functional change intended.
+Compile tested only.

+Subject: [PATCH] netdevice: add netdev_tx_reset_subqueue() shorthand
+
+Add a shorthand similar to other net*_subqueue() helpers for resetting
+the queue by its index w/o obtaining &netdev_tx_queue beforehand
+manually.
